Suites SUNNYVALE, Calif., Jan. 25 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Endwave
Defense Systems,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Endwave Corporation
(NASDAQ:ENWV) and leading provider of innovative high-frequency
subsystem solutions for homeland security, government, and other
defense electronics, today announced the execution of a 10-month
development agreement with a major U.S. prime contractor to design
and deliver prototype low power amplifiers for use in the back-fit
of an airborne defense system. The $518,000 award is the second
development contract to Endwave in eight months aimed at upgrading
and prolonging onboard mission-critical subsystems in the 20+
year-old NATO aircraft fleet. Prototype deliveries are expected to
occur during the fourth quarter of 2005. Upon successful field
qualification testing, low rate production is expected to be
authorized beginning in 2006 and extending two to four years. While
prototype development will occur in the company's Sunnyvale,
California headquarters, production would occur in Endwave Defense
Systems' Manufacturing Center of Excellence located in Diamond
Springs, California. "This development agreement is another example

of Endwave. About Endwave Endwave Corporation develops and
manufactures radio frequency (RF) subsystems for use in high-speed
cellular backhaul networks, enterprise access, commercial radar
systems and other broadband applications. Through its wholly-owned
subsidiary, Endwave Defense Systems Incorporated, the company
supplies innovative high-frequency subsystem solutions to homeland
security, government, and other defense electronics applications.
Endwave's products include transmitters, receivers, integrated
transceivers, outdoor units, oscillators and synthesizers,
high-power cellular switch-combiners, and RF modules (amplifiers,
frequency multipliers, switches, and up/down-converters). Endwave
and its subsidiaries have more than 35 issued patents covering
their core technologies including semiconductor and proprietary
circuit designs. Endwave Corporation is headquartered in Sunnyvale,
CA, with operations in Diamond Springs, CA; Andover, MA; and
Lamphun, Thailand. Additional information about the company can be
